When requesting abatement of penalties for reasonable cause, your statement should include supporting documentation and address the following items: The reason the penalty was charged. The daily delinquency penalty may be charged for either a late filed return, an incomplete return, or both.

3. Structure Your Letter Properly Your name, address, and contact information. A statement expressing your desire to appeal the IRS's findings. The tax period(s) in question. A list of the items you disagree with and why. Facts supporting your position. Any relevant law or authority supporting your case.

The IRS will review your correspondence and respond ingly. Allow at least 30 days for reply. There's usually no need to call the department.

If you are paper-filing the amended to the IRS... send the 1040x, the amended forms with a watermark ``As Amended''. Original forms with a watermark ``As Originally Filed''. You can write on the form, it doesn't have to be a ``watermark''. One big staple, with 1040x on top, next the amended, last as originally filed.

On Form 1040-X, enter your income, deductions, and credits from your return as originally filed or as previously adjusted by either you or the IRS, the changes you are making, and the corrected amounts. Then, figure the tax on the corrected amount of taxable income and the amount you owe or your refund.

File an amended return using Form 1040-X, Amended U.S. Individual Income Tax Return as soon as possible.
